How Often to Change Your Spark Plugs
If you want to keep your vehicle running smoothly, routine automotive maintenance is a must. This includes changing spark plugs at the proper interval, but how often do you change spark plugs? While experts generally recommend replacing spark plugs every 30,000 miles, it can vary depending on the make and model you drive around Jacksonville. There may also be different recommendations from the automaker, which can be found in your owner’s manual. When Do I Change Spark Plugs?
What is the purpose of spark plugs? These tiny components are part of the ignition system, and they work by moving the high voltage current from the ignition coil to ignite the combustion chamber when you start the vehicle. You may notice a couple of warning signs if your spark plugs are not functioning properly. These signals can include:
- Slow or no start
- Engine misfires
- Engine running rough
- Rough idling
- Poor acceleration
- High fuel consumption
Why Do I Need to Change Spark Plugs?
Not only can changing your spark plugs prevent the issues mentioned above, there are also additional benefits of keeping up with this simple task.
- Improved fuel economy – Having a worn out spark plug can reduce your fuel economy by as much as 30%. Spend less time and money at the pump with properly functioning spark plugs.
- Consistent combustion system – Spark plugs allow for the continuous production of combustion and allow your vehicle to perform as the automaker intended.
- Your Vehicle Starts Smoothly – When your spark plugs are performing as they should, your vehicle will start effortlessly.
- Less harmful emissions – Replacing your vehicle’s spark plugs can help your vehicle run as efficiently as possible and also improve your emissions.
